10 Best React UI Frameworks & Component Libraries to consider for Faster Web App Development!


React.js, popularly known as React, is an open-source JavaScript library that facilitates the creation of user-centric web apps with an unmatched user interface. React is a preferred choice for web app development owing to advantages like code reusability, effortless scripting, SEO-friendliness, easy learning curve, cost-efficiency, and high speed due to the usage of a virtual DOM.

For developing React web apps faster and more conveniently, developers and designers leverage the components offered by React frameworks and component libraries. React components are independent bits of code that are reusable. These components play a crucial role in improving the speed, efficiency, and productivity of web app development projects.

This post enlists the best React libraries and React frameworks of 2022 that ensure faster web app development.

Significant React UI Frameworks & React Component Libraries

1. React Bootstrap

This React UI framework is one of the best options for a front-end web development. React-Bootstrap has replaced JavaScript-Bootstrap. Here, the native Bootstrap components are offered as pure React components. The creators of this library have not made use of JavaScript-based sources and plugins from the CDN. Instead, all the components have been re-built in React without using unnecessary dependencies like iQuery.

This library offers a wide variety of components that optimize accessibility. Using React Bootstrap, projects can be designed on the back end and prototyped on the front end. Hence, it is immensely useful in web development projects where teams are working on various aspects of an app. Moreover, it has well-created documentation along with code samples and enjoys 19.8k GitHub stars.

2. Semantic UI React

This is an open-source React CSS framework with 12.4 k GitHub stars comprising wholly featured React UI libraries. Semantic UI React is the official React integration into the originally existing Semantic UI framework. This version of the Semantic UI is jQuery-free; the jQuery features have been re-implemented using React.

Semantic UI React offers a plethora of pre-built components that help React developers create semantically friendly codes. Its declarative API facilitates building robust features and validating props. Thanks to its powerful augmentation, props and component features can be built without having to include additional nested components. This leads to the creation of unique component features. Besides, there are Shorthand props that help in generating markups. The sub-components available, help in accessing and editing markups; this provides flexibility while customizing components. The functionality, auto-controlled state, plays a crucial role in extending the concept of React’s controlled and uncontrolled components. Here, the components self-manage themselves without the need for wiring. This makes it easier for developers to manage props with the help of React UI libraries.
3. Ant Design

Ant Design is one of the most suitable React UI frameworks that facilitates the development of enterprise-grade web apps. It’s written in TypeScript and contains predictable static types. This library offers quality components and demos for designing high-end and interactive user interfaces. One of its unique features includes internationalization support for numerous languages. This popular library boasts 70k GitHub stars and has been utilized by renowned brands like Tencent, Baidu, and Alibaba.

Ant Design comes with several amazing components including dropdown menus, grids, icons, buttons, breadcrumb, and pagination. Moreover, you will be able to customize the components as per your design specification requirements.

4. MUI (Previously known as Material UI)

This is one of the most sought-after open-sourced React frameworks that contributes a great deal to enhance the speed of the web development process. MUI, architected in JavaScript (63.9%) and TypeScript (36.1%), is not merely a component library; it offers a whole design system. It comes with a host of foundational as well as advanced pre-built components and templates for navigation, forms, layouts, data display, and many more. Moreover, each component fulfills the present accessibility standards and can be customized as per the user’s requirement. Therefore, users need not waste time reinventing the wheel. Furthermore, it offers cross-browser compatibility; it can be used along with other frameworks like Angular & Vue.js for building that perfect web solution.

MUI provides multiple top-grade components for free usage. However, some components like the Date Range Picker and Data Grid, have been locked for free users. Those features can be accessed by MUI X Pro package users and offer advanced components and themes that allow you to create high-end digital experiences.

This powerful framework is maintained by a huge and vibrant community comprising indispensable contributors. There exists a comprehensive documentation and hence, developers enjoy an easy learning curve.

MUI boasts of 69.2k GitHub stars and 22.7k forks. It has been utilized for 745,000 + projects.

5. Chakra UI

This component library is simple and accessible; it offers the fundamental building blocks required for React app development. It comes with themes, 49 components like icons, inputs, tooltips, accordions, etc., and some handy custom hooks. It also offers various colors that can be used to change the brightness & darkness level as per the UI. These components adhere to the WAI-ARIA standards, are highly reusable, and can be easily customized. The modularity of the components enables developers to create efficient and clean codes. Chakra UI also has a dynamic community that extends a helping hand in case of any blocking issue.

6. Fluent UI

Fluent UI contains a collection of UX frameworks that helps in crafting alluring cross-platform web applications that share the design, code, and interaction behavior.

This open-source Microsoft-developed design system offers designers as well as developers outstanding web components utilities, and React components needed for creating an engaging UX. Fluent UI offers extensible JavaScript solutions for component state, accessibility, and styling. It has a simple API based on natural language and loads of robust features including internationalization and performance. The pre-built components offered by this library can be employed for designing major chunks of the web app.

It has 12K GitHub stars and comprehensive documentation. It has been employed for Microsoft sites like One Note, Office 365, DevOps, Azure, etc.

7. Grommet

This React framework, created by HPE, offers a neat package of over sixty components that provide modularity, accessibility, responsiveness, and theming capabilities. Additionally, you get Figma, AdobeXd files, Sketch, and over 600 SVG icons.

This lightweight tool offers color controls, layouts, templates, input visualization, etc. It enables one to create bold and captivating website designs that are unique. Grommet facilitates the development of mobile-friendly apps. Grommet enjoys 7.4K stars on GitHub and has been leveraged by several biggies including IBM, Uber, Netflix, Boeing, and Samsung.

8. Blueprint UI

This React component framework is a handy tool for developing complex and data-intensive UIs of web apps and desktops. It offers 40+ new-era components for building desktop apps. Blueprint UI is built using TypeScript, JavaScript, SCSS, and unspecified code. You can access the light and dark themes as per your need. The components include Table packages, Datetime icons, etc. With this library, you can customize color themes, classes, and typography, to tailor a personalized design. This library is the most suitable pick for architecting a data-dense desktop app employing pre-built components. The library has in-depth documentation as well.

9. Shards React

This open-source new-age React framework offers numerous options to web development teams for building web portals, precise dashboards, and mobile apps that cater to diverse industrial domains. Shards provide a wide range of components including custom React components like toggle inputs and sliders. Its basic library is free; the paid version (pro kit) offers extra components, blocks, and templates. Also, the pro version offers 15 pre-built pages that help one to get started.

This component library uses React Popper (positioning engine), React Datepicker, noUISlider; and supports Fontawesome and Material icons. The SCSS is employed for styling, elevating the developer experience.

Shards offers web development professionals the ideal blend of customization options. Moreover, it allows one to download source files so that modifications can be made at the code level as well. Shards functions speedily as well as efficiently on various platforms because of its optimized code.

10. React 360

Today, augmented reality and virtual reality are some of the most disruptive technologies that are leveraged by several industry verticals, particularly the eCommerce sector. Usually, a combination of AI and VR is employed to provide consumers with a virtual reality experience for trying out a product. This trend is gaining traction in other industries as well.

Have you ever imagined that such an AR/VR experience can be created with React? With the introduction of React 360, you can integrate AI and VR experiences in React apps as well. Using this library, React developers can create VR and 3D user interfaces that function across mobile/web apps, desktops, and VR devices. And, the best part is developers can create such immersive user experiences using standard React components and tools. React 360 allows you to build 2D interfaces embedded within 3D spaces and handle immersive experiences in a better way. The architecture of this library is meant to optimize the app’s performance as it reduces garbage collection and improves the frame rate.

Key Factors affecting the Cost of React Native App Development!


The first set of questions that cross the mind of every aspiring entrepreneur planning to develop a mobile app are:

Which app development framework is profitable and most widely adopted?

What are the factors that influence the development cost?

What is the approximate cost during various stages of the project?

Well, React Native framework is one of the most viable options for developing applications. Its unique capabilities in comparison to the Native development options are:

  • Code-sharing ability across multiple platforms
  • Ability to craft responsive and fast-loading apps
  • Availability of pre-built and reusable components
  • Faster time-to-market
  • Involves lesser resources and smaller teams

As per a developer survey conducted by Statista in 2020, “React Native is the most popular cross-platform framework used by 42% of the software developers around the globe.

Now, you must be curious to know about all aspects concerning the development cost in React Native projects! Read along to gather insights on the factors affecting the React Native app development cost and also get a rough estimate of the expenses incurred during each stage of the project.

Factors affecting React Native Application Development Cost

The Design of the App

A well-devised app design is necessary to stay competitive. Devising a well-articulated user flow, well-timed animation, and smooth transitions for navigating between screens, enhances user engagement; but turns out to be super-expensive. Nonetheless, React Native App design costs lesser than that of Native apps; as only one app with cross-platform compatibility needs to be designed.

App Categories

The business requirement for each kind of application vary and so the elements like feature set, the number of real-time users, security considerations, etc. are different for each category of apps. Naturally, the development cost differs as per the number and type of intricacies employed. For instance, simple apps like calendars, calculators, etc. will involve lesser developmental costs as compared to complex, feature-rich apps like mCommerce or customized apps. The reason is integrating more features takes much longer than usual.

App Complexity

The entire mobile app development process usually takes about one week to six months to get completed. The time-to-market, as well as the developmental cost, is directly proportional to the level of complexity, number of functionalities, and the ingenuity of the features. For instance, a project involving the development of a simple app or MVP costs less and is much quicker to execute. Contrarily, a complex application possessing new-fangled features takes longer to develop and incurs more expenses.

All apps are categorized into three levels: High complexity, Medium complexity, and Low Complexity. The factors that determine the level of complexity are as follows:

The Architecture of Deployment Model: For backend development, you can either opt for the Custom approach or BaaS. The custom approach allows the React Native development companies to get the desired mobile architecture tailored to their specific needs; whereas those employing BaaS, have to function using a ready-made backend architecture.

Developing the Admin Panel: Admin panel enables app owners to efficiently manage the React Native app: keeping track of the app’s activity, viewing statistics, and updating the content without developer intervention. The more features you integrate into the Admin Panel, the higher the app ranks in the complexity chart.

Integrating third-party plugins: Integrating third-party plugins is necessary to make an app more user-friendly. These plugins allow the app to interact with other app’s functionality for simplifying processes such as login and payment. However, such integrations are more complicated to implement using React Native app development as compared to Native development.

Utilizing the Device’s built-in features: The new-age tablets and smartphones are decked up with advanced features like GPS, Bluetooth, Barometers, Nearby, etc. which can be linked to an app for enhanced performance, thereby increasing the app’s complexity.

Adding in-app purchase: Most of the popular applications these days possess the ‘in-app purchase’ feature for accelerating ROI. So, app creators are tempted to include this feature, making the app more complex.

Integrating the app with Enterprise or Legacy System: A React Native app can either be a standalone or an integrated one. A standalone app functions independently without being integrated into your system and so is a budget-friendly option. But, the apps that are integrated within any of your enterprise/legacy systems; involve a series of complexities like third-party APIs, extensions, host system modifications in the app, etc. resulting in a more expensive development process.

User Login/Authorization

Crafting applications that do not need any type of user login/authorization and user authentication, involve lesser costs. Contrarily, an app providing these functions incurs more costs as it needs to undergo the process of role-based checks, set by developers. Moreover, the app’s complexity increases, as both the system development team and the app development team of the enterprise need to invest efforts for flawless development and deployment of the application.

Add-ons to the App

The React Native framework enables the creation of captivating apps. But, if one intends to develop a customer-centric app, that app has to be integrated with Social media channels or provided with other custom add-ons. These additional elements push up the expenses. Nevertheless, the need for add-ons depends on the preferences and requirements of clients.

Hardware Dependency

Certain applications like the IoT-powered ones need to be connected with different kinds of hardware. The more the hardware dependency of an application, the greater is the cost of development. Furthermore, utilizing React Native to create an app with hardware connections is more complicated as compared to the Native approach.

App Distribution Expenses

An app is usually deployed via distribution channels and each channel possesses a different pricing policy. The developer license cost charged by stores like the App Store or Google Play is somewhere around $100. Additionally, some apps require permissions from the host, concerning aspects like adherence to security policies, compliance of standards, etc.

Expertise, Size, and Location of the Development Team

The expertise of React Native app developers and the size and location of the development team define the project cost to a considerable extent. Take a look!

The hourly rate of experienced and skilled developers or a huge development team will be much higher, but they are capable of handling complex projects. Hiring freelancers, on the other hand, is a highly affordable option, but the work quality is often compromised. Therefore, opt for freelancers if your project is a simple one, with a flexible completion deadline and you have budget constraints. But, in the case of a complex project with a specified timeline, it is advisable to partner with a React Native App Development Company. Again, high-cap development firms will charge more as they have set high standards in the market. However, a mid-cap app development firm will be a good option to go for; as their hourly rate is comparatively lesser – 41 USD (approximately); and they are more open to executing innovative app ideas.

Besides, the rates vary as per the geographical location of the React Native app Development services you have hired for project execution. The hourly rates are higher in places like Australia, Europe, and North America and comparatively lower in places like Latin America, India, and other Asian countries.

React Native App Cost estimate

Here’s a rough estimate of the app development expenses through various stages.

  • The discovery stage – validating app idea, competitive analysis, deciding the target audience, creating the roadmap – generally costs less than $ 5,000.
  • Wireframing and prototyping including the creation of visual presentations and lo-fi sketches consume 40 – 50 hours approximately.
  • The design and development stage comprises major functions like UI creation and implementation, front-end, and back-end development, testing, etc. As such this stage involves 50% to 70% of the overall developmental expenses.
  • Maintenance and support post-launch – bug fixes, updates like revamping the design to keep up with changing trends, adding new features, etc. – are essential for user engagement and retention. This stage accounts for about 20-25% of the total development cost.

Top 8 Tools for Debugging React Native Applications!

 


Debugging an application is the most essential part of the complete React Native development process before the application is pushed to the production phase. This is true for other technologies as well. Debugging involves thorough checking of the code and helps in the early detection of error conditions. Fixing these errors or bugs during the development process, instead of fixing them in the production stages can be highly economical for every React Native development company.  

So, how does the debugging take place in React Native? Well, thanks to the availability of a wide range of React Native debugging tools that help the developers debug their code efficiently in a short time.

This read is a brief guide for you, where we will be exploring the most popular React Native debugging tools used worldwide. So let’s quickly get started.

Most Efficient Debugging Tools for React Native Developers


Chrome DevTools

‘Chrome DevTools’ is usually the first name that comes to the mind of a React Native developer for debugging the code of an app. Being powered by JavaScript, this tool enables the debugging of both- web apps as well as mobile apps. The React Native framework supports this tool through its remote debugging abilities by default.

So how does this tool work?

When your React Native app is running on Android Emulator and you have to access the in-app developer menu, press ‘Cmd+M’ on Mac or ‘Ctrl+M’ on Windows. When the app runs on a real device, simply shake the device. Now, a menu will appear and you need to click on “Debug JS Remotely” to open the Google Chrome debugger. After this, press   ‘Command+Option+I’ on Mac or ‘Ctrl+Shift+I’ on Windows to open Developer Tools. You can now use console statements and debug the app. You may view your code by clicking on the Developer Tools Sources tab and open-sourcing the files. From here, you can add breakpoints and easily debug the app using the ‘Chrome DevTools’.

The Developer Menu

The developer menu comes with a plethora of options for the developers to do various things, as given below:

  • Reloading option for reloading the app
  • Enabling Hot Reloading for watching the changes accumulated in a changed file
  • Debugging js remotely for opening a channel to a JS Debugger
  • Enabling Live Reloading for allowing the app to automatically reload when the save button is clicked
  • Toggle Inspector for toggling an inspector interface. It enables the developers to inspect a UI element present on the screen along with its properties. This interface has some other tabs too, which include a tab for performance and for networking that show us the HTTP calls

React Native Debugger

This is a stand-alone desktop application that works on Linux, Mac, and Windows and one of the most recommended debugging tools. It can be integrated with the other two tools- React’s Developer Tools and Redux DevTools, thus giving you the best of both tools. This combination doesn’t require any setup and can be installed quickly with ease. With this combination, react native developers can get some of the best features as below:

  • Profiler: Identify performance issues by getting a flamegraph with components
  • Elements: for examining the styles of the elements, editing them, and instantly viewing the results in the simulator
  • Console: for examining different errors and warning messages
  • Network: for checking and recording network requests
  • Sources: for debugging JS, setting breakpoints, and walking through the code.
  • Memory: for detecting any memory leaks

React Developer Tools

Due to the two reasons mentioned below, it is considered one of the best tools for debugging React Native.

  1. This tool allows the debugging of React components.
  2. Its new version also allows debugging styles in React Native and also works simultaneously in the developer menu with the inspector. In this version, the developers can debug and employ the style properties and without even reloading the app, they can instantly see the modifications implemented in the app.

So how to get started with this tool?

You need to use the desktop app for debugging React Native with this tool. It can be installed locally as well as globally in the project by using the below command- “yarn add react-devtools” or npm- “npm install react-devtools --save”

Now you can start the application by running the command- “yarn react-devtools” which will launch your application.

Reactotron

This open-source desktop app was designed in 2016 by Infinite Red. This tool enables the inspecting of the apps quite effortlessly. It is available for various operating systems like Linux, Mac, and Windows. It offers amazing features like:

  • state tab
  • React Native tab
  • timeline tab for tracking app events and Redux actions
  • connections for running several devices simultaneously and quickly switching debugging

Redux DevTools

Redux DevTools is also a standalone tool and a state container for JS applications. It is meant for both- React Native and React JS. It is used for common state management and allows easy inspection between actions and their reflections on the data store. Redux DevTools allows using redux debug components directly into the applications. This tool comes with several useful features such as Chart, Slider, Inspector showing real-time actions, Dispatcher, State tab, Action tab, Diff tab, Log Monitor, Test tab, Export/import, etc. You can start using this tool by installing the Redux Devtools Extension to the firefox or chrome browser.

React Native CLI

This tool is majorly used for the development of React Native apps but also used as a debugging tool at times. React Native CLI helps to access some relevant information about the dependencies and libraries used in the app. This information can be then used for debugging some bugs that take place due to a mismatch of different versions of tools being used for your app development.

Nuclide

Nuclide is also an open-source tool and comes with the support of a strong community. It can be added as a plug-in on top of Atom- a renowned IDE built by Facebook. It offers some outstanding features like auto-complete, jump-to-definition, inline errors, etc. Also, it provides services like Hack development, Remote, and JavaScript development, working sets, built-in debugging, task runner, mercurial support, etc.

Flutter Vs React Native app development services: Which one to opt for in 2020?

 

“Have you thought of a sensational app idea, but unable to decide the right software development framework for it?”Well, this is a common issue faced by several app creators and even businesses planning to build cross-platform applications, as there are a host of outstanding frameworks to choose from.

As per the latest trends, the leading cross-platform app development frameworks are React Native and Flutter. Facebook, Bloomberg, Instagram, Myntra, Pinterest, Office365 apps, etc. are products of React Native app development while Google Ads, Alibaba, Hamilton Musical, Coach Yourself, etc. are products of Flutter app development. Both of these frameworks are loaded with several goodies. Hence, a thorough comparative analysis of these frameworks is necessary before choosing any of these.

My article compares Flutter and React Native, weighing their upsides and downsides. Reading this article will guide you through selecting the right app development framework to shape your app idea.

React Native vs Flutter: Faceoff            

React Native, introduced by Facebook in 2015, is an open-source app development framework targeting the Web, iOS, Android, and UWP.

Google’s brainchild, Flutter came into being in 2017. It is an open-source UI toolkit for developing apps for iOS, Android, Windows, Google Fuchsia, Linux, Mac, and the web.

Let’s compare them based on the following parameters.

Programming languages used

React Native is based on JavaScript, a popular programming language. The good news is that most professional developers have experience in working with JavaScript, and so a React Native app development company can easily find the required expertise.

Flutter uses Dart, a new programming language coined by Google that is not known to many developers. However, Dart is easy to master as it enables faster compiling of the native code and allows easy customization of widgets. But, one of its major downsides is that Dart skills cannot be used for non-flutter projects.

Inference: Although Dart is developer-friendly and has an easy learning curve, React Native is preferred owing to the huge resource availability for JavaScript. However, it is advisable to try Flutter, if your development team lacks prior technical experience.

UI and UX

  • React Native offers the following benefits regarding the UI and UX:
  • The users experience a nearly-native look and feel as the widgets and buttons appear in the form of native components. As such, even Hybrid Android and iOS apps built in React Native provide a native app experience.
  • Whenever the UI of the Operating System is updated; the app components get updated simultaneously.
  • The React Native Developers can choose from a wide variety of external UI kits like React Native Elements, React Native Material Kit, Native Base, etc. UI kits offered by React Native are far more in number than Flutter.
  • React Native provides good support to the style components of iOS.    

Flutter offers the following features for User Interface.

  • Flutter uses the proprietary interactive, platform, and visual widgets that are nothing but built-in UI components. These built-in components replace native components.
  • Owing to its layered architecture there is good UI flexibility. It simplifies as well as fastens the processes of rendering graphics and customizing the widgets.
  • Flutter’s widgets namely Cupertino and material design allow the developers to copy platform-specific native components.
  • The pixel rendering feature in Flutter helps to manage each pixel on the screen. This makes the User Interface appear the same regardless of the device on which the app is installed, thereby minimizing support woes.

Inference: React Native delivers a nearly-native UX whereas Flutter provides more flexibility for creating the UI design.

Code Styling and Structure

Flutter app development eliminates the need to separate templates, data, style, etc. It allows developers to code anything from a single centralized location and gives access to all the necessary tools. But, as of now the code-sharing functionality has been implemented for Android and iOS apps only.

React Native has a more complicated code structure as compared to Flutter but employs third-party libraries to share the code across iOS, Android, Windows, and the web.

Inference: Despite Flutter’s simple and organized code structure, React Native is one step ahead as it provides more code-sharing options, enabling developers to focus on code creation without worrying about compatibility concerns.

Performance

React Native uses JavaScript for connecting with native components through a bridge whereas Flutter eliminates the need for a bridge for interacting with native components. This speeds up the developmental process.

While architecting hybrid apps with React Native, it becomes quite complex and challenging for React Native developers to run the libraries and native components without issues. Flutter contrarily eases out things for developers as the existing code can be reused effortlessly. Also, Flutter is supported by the C++ engine which ensures better performance in the end-product.

Unlike React Native, Flutter has been compiled into the native ARM code for iOS as well as Android, and so it never encounters any performance woes.

Inference: Flutter surpasses React Native in terms of performance.

Other differences

  • React Native offers APIs that support Bluetooth, Geo-location, and other features. If there is a requirement for native interfaces like Wi-Fi, NFC payments, biometrics, etc., React Native is the right choice. But it lacks the tools required to customize the graphics. Flutter, apart from easily offering various APIs, makes use of the Skia Graphics Library that processes the graphics and loads apps faster.
  • Owing to the ready-to-use components, React Native involves a speedier development cycle than Flutter.
  • Flutter’s documentation is well-organized, detailed, and easyto understand while React Native’s documentation is a bit disorganized.
  • Hot Reloading works much faster in Flutter than in React Native.
  • Flutter, being a newbie lacks the strong community support that is enjoyed by React Native.
  • React Native offers lesser testing tools and depends on third-party toolsets. Flutter, on the contrary, offers a rich toolset to test apps at the widget, unit, and integration levels.

React Native or Swift: Which one to choose for iOS app development?

 


iOS apps, being the second largest contributor to top-notch mobility solutions and revenue generation because of its world-wide usage, corporate entities and businesses are leveraging iOS app development at a fast pace. Let’s look at some enticing insights by Business of Apps, a reputed online portal for statistics. Their report forecasts:

  • In May 2019, the number of apps published in the iOS App Store was 2.2 million.
  • Every month, about 35,000-42,000 apps were uploaded on the iOS App Store between March and May 2019.
  • The annual growth rate of iOS App Store Revenue is 13.2%.

Another well-known research portal- Statista forecasts that in the U.S.  alone, the average user spending on iPhone apps amounted to $100 in the year 2019 which was reported to be $79 in the year 2018.

Looking at the figures above, it is evident that iOS appsrakes in far more revenue than Android apps. No wonder why this market is blooming and expecting massive investment from entrepreneurs across the globe.

But the real challenge arises when it comes to the choice of the right technology for building the iOS applications. For this purpose, the two technologies- React Native and Swift are largely being preferred. Both are relatively new yet vibrant. So which one to pick for your new iOS app?

To resolve this query, I will outline the advantages and drawbacks of both these technologies and also walk you through the comparative analysis of both. So, let’s get started.

Native App Development with Swift

Swift is the first technology that comes to mind when we think of iOS development. Swift is the best-suited option for complicated apps that need to take advantage of the native components to the fullest. So, let’s have a look at the pros and cons.

Pros of Swift App Development
  • Easy to read and ensures faster and effective coding
  • Requires less maintenance and better handling of errors
  • Easy scaling and compatibility with all Apple product
  • Higher performance and captivating UI
  • High safety and security
  • Compatibility with Objective C

Cons of Swift App Development

  • Young language with a limited talent pool
  • Bad interoperability with third-party tools and IDEs
  • No proper support for earlier iOS versions

Also read our article- “Why Start-ups Prefer Swift Over Objective-C” for more details.

Cross-platform App Development with React Native

This framework is a combination of JavaScript library and native components. It is a cross-platform framework used for building fully-functional apps having simple design requirements. So, let’s look at some pros and cons of React Native.

Pros of React Native App Development
  • Code reusability, third-party plugins, hot reload feature, lesser efforts for debugging, etc. for speedy development
  • Provides optimal performance with native controls and modules
  • Provides native features like scroll accelerations, animations, keyboard behaviour, usability, UI with native widgets, gestures, push notifications, camera, location, etc,
  • Simplified and responsive UI
  • Allows feature expanding with ease

Cons of React Native App Development
  • Issues with memory management
  • App Store rejects these apps if these apps use libraries that dynamically updates native code
  • Platform specific code needs to be written to create native functionality
  • Frequent updates required to the app as this framework updates its components very often

Also read our article “https://www.biz4solutions.com/blog/noteworthy-pros-and-cons-of-the-react-native-framework/” for more details.

React Native vs Swift: Comparative Analysis

Coding Speed

Both of these technologies ensure faster app development. React Native, being a cross-platform framework, allows reusing the code due to which a single code can be utilized for developing apps for multiple platforms. Swift requires less code for the same task as this language is very crisp.

Cost-effectiveness

In React Native apps, the overall development cost is reduced by 30%-35% as compared to Swift. So, for a limited budget requirement, React Native is the most relevant option. Besides if Swift is used for iOS app development, separate code needs to be written for Android apps.

Performance

Swift leverages all the possibilities of the device. This platform fares better when dealing with complex tasks and graphic effects. App developed with React Native have to leverage internal libraries and APIs. Hence React Native Developers need to create required modules on their own. This means that they have to add a mediator between platform and code which impacts the performance of the app.

User Interface

React Native enables building native-like UI in the apps but it does not match the quality that Swift offers. Swift seamlessly integrates with the iOS platform for creating remarkable UI. But the Swift app developers need to write the code from scratch and separately polish the design elements. React Native developers can use ready-to-use components and internal APIs for creating a simplified UI which can adjust to different screen sizes automatically.

Security

React Native uses third-party libraries like React-native-sensitive-info, React-native-keychain, and React-native-secure-storage for securing data in the apps. On the other hand, Swift offers high security using its technologies like Cryptographic Message Syntax Services, Randomization Services, Keychain Services API, etc. Swift ensures better security than React Native.

APIs and Third-party Libraries

React Native’s constantly growing community often adds third-party libraries and enriches this framework. Likewise, Swift also has a host of open-source libraries and APIs to support the smooth functioning of the apps.

Maintenance

React Native app development services face several maintenance issues while updating codes, compatibility with third-party libraries, and many other unresolved issues. For every new version of react native framework that is released, developer needs to check whether updated version works with the library version being used in the app. But Swift,being a statically-typed programming language, can be easily maintained and errors can be handled easily.

Community Support

Both Swift and React Native have powerful communities to support and respective developers enjoy assistance from worldwide technical experts in case of any doubts.

Final Words:

Coming to the end of this blog, both these technologies are powerful and have their set of pros and cons. After all, it depends on your end goals and budget constraints.

Swift is a great tool when you want to develop a complex, performance-oriented and highly secured app. It is a good choice when you want to maintain the app for longer time, if the app requires frequent interactions with UI like resource intensive games, etc.

But React Native is best when you aim to reach a wide range of audiences through both iOS and Android platform, with comparatively lower investment due to code reusability for multiple platforms, etc.

Why your Business should consider React Native App Development?


In 2012, Mark Zuckerberg commented that their biggest mistake was to give much attention to HTML5 as compared to native. He also added that Facebook would soon find a better solution to deliver a superior mobile experience. After months of experiment and hard work, Facebook found this solution and it was named React Native which is a cross-platform framework. Since then, React Native has not looked back and brought a revolutionary shift in the mobile app development world. React Native app development has tremendous potential and is being used by several popular brands like Myntra, Uber Eats, Pinterest, Instagram, Delivery.com, Gyroscope, etc. React Native is known for developing responsive, feature-rich, powerful, and business-empowering applications. Mobile app developers are leveraging the full potential of this framework to create competent iOS and Android mobile apps with native capabilities.  

In this article, we have outlined the top advantages of React Native app development and the reasons why businesses should consider it for developing applications.

Why Businesses should prefer React Native app development?

Highly Cost-effective
For start-ups and small and medium-sized businesses, the main concern is the budget factor. They have tight budget constraints and want quick returns on their investment. Since React Native is a cross-platform framework, the businesses can get high-quality mobile apps developed for iOS and Android simultaneously through a single codebase. This reduces the development cost and saves time to a great extent.

Easy Learning curve
For building iOS apps, developers need to learn Swift and Java for Android apps. However, if they know JavaScript, they can easily go for React Native app development. The developers simply need to be aware of some basic design patterns and UI elements as React Native library consists of Flexbox CSS styling, inline styling, debugging, deployment support, etc. for uploading the App on Google Play and App Store.

React Native Component Libraries enabling reusability
React is an open-source JavaScript library that helps to develop interfaces for both mobile apps and web apps using numerous readily usable isolated components. It assists the developers in maintaining the code very easily. Using pre-made components saves a lot of development time and eliminates the need to code from scratch. Some of the examples of react-native libraries are NativeBase, Teaset, Material Kit React Native, React Native Elements, etc.

Faster Time-to-market
Due to code-reusability and ready-to-use components, building a basic MVP model with React Native is possible in a short time. Consequently, the companies can launch their MVP version quickly in the market to know the app’s potential and also grab the attention of investors. This also gives a competitive edge to the app owners.

Open-source Framework supported by Facebook
React Native is an open-source framework supported by Facebook which uses native UI controls and gives full access to the native platform. Since Facebook itself uses React Native, their technical team keeps introducing new and innovative features, libraries, functionalities, etc. The React Native app developers can consult this community for any doubts or fixing bugs without additional charges, thereby reducing the chances of failure of their apps. Additionally, companies like Microsoft, Infinite Red, Software Mansion, Callstack, etc. have contributed to this framework.

Third-party Plugin Support
Using third-party plugins isn’t considered that secure at times and it is also difficult to apply. But in React Native app development, these plugins can be used with ease and flexibility. These plugins allow the app to have a good performance during run-time.  

Also, this framework has a modular architecture which helps to have better integration with these 3rd party tools. Due to this, the developers can segregate the program functions into several blocks called modules. These are free and interchangeable modules that can be reused for mobile and web APIs. This architecture ensures flexible programming and the apps can be upgraded quickly. Moreover, as cross-bridge linking is not essential and, because the code is being run in real-time, it uses less memory space.

Why Should Start-Ups Go for React Native Mobile App Development?



While developing a mobile app, start-ups have the aim of reaching a wider audience at once and building a brand out of their product. Cross-platform app development allows the building of attractive mobile apps for multiple platforms using a single code-base and enabling start-ups to reach a large market in one go. However, in the past, when companies had to build an app, the only option was to build separate apps for different platforms. React Native framework is a functional cross-platform program for developing powerful apps for both platforms- Android and iOS. It has great potential for building innovative applications for different businesses. After the tremendous success of React Native, many businesses, especially start-ups prefer this framework.

Why choose React Native mobile app development for your start-up?

As we can see, many successful names in the business world have used React Native. It has already become a winning choice of many. Have a look at the positive potentials of React Native that benefit a start-up.

Budget-friendly: Using this framework, the developers can write a single code and run it on both platforms. It makes the work smoother and faster for React Native developers.  This reduces the development time by approximately 30-35%. It also reduces the cost to a great extent which is the best benefit to a start-up.

Faster time-to-market: React Native helps faster development of MVP version of the apps which is a plus point for start-ups. MVP version makes the basic product available in the market at the earliest for grabbing the attention of the investors quickly, thus giving a competitive edge to the app owners. 

Better UI/UX: If compared with other frameworks like AngularJS, React Native looks like a JavaScript library and not as a framework. It provides a simplified and platform-specific user interface in mobile apps. Also, the apps are more responsive with reduced loading times. React Native uses third-party libraries for developers.

Enhanced Security: The apps built using React Native are difficult to hack. React Native uses JavaScript, which is the core programming language and the chances of errors are very less. So, these apps have high security and reliability.

Reusability of Native components: With this framework, start-ups can extend the functionalities of their apps by using native components like GPS, phone camera, maps, etc. It provides a Native UX feeling to the apps making them more useful and captivating. However, the developers should know about native development to leverage this benefit.

Availability of talented pool: As said earlier, this framework uses JavaScript, which is the most popular language. It is known to more than 67% developers, as per a survey conducted by Stack Overflow. So, there is a huge pool of talented developers available.

Stable framework with big community support: React Native is comparatively new, yet much stable framework. Thanks to Facebook and its active support. Facebook itself uses the React Native framework on Facebook and Instagram mobile apps. Their team consistently works on improving the framework. They keep introducing innovative features, new libraries and functionalities. So, with React Native mobile app development, start-ups get the support of a huge community and the chances of failure of the apps are rare.
